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60088273551 48 3946237 5202652
99302433 650
99302433 650
343021 2709634398 3878608903
All about undefined
Interested in learning more?
99302433 650
343021 2709634398 3878608903
See more
32502396 8177836 200234459
7826715 39 7558 789 8007804
See more
71 241 22854031
2437 323012 049 7988978534
See more